Melbourne artist and songwriter JXN is a pop culture master. Starting his journey as an OG influencer and sketch artist on the app Vine, he quickly rose to the most followed Australian on the platform before turning his efforts to his first love, music. JXN has penned lyrics and melody for Swedish mega DJ Mike Perry’s “I Can’t Love” (30M+ streams), Aussie icons Peking Duk’s APRA Award nominated “Spend It” and collaborated with iconic rap artist A Boogie Wit da Hoodie. Recently JXN contributed topline and vocals to breaking Australian DJ WILL K’s latest single “Hot Off The Press” (Sweat It Out). His ability to capture hearts and laughs through his lyrics is his clear weapon as a writer – he’s just as comfortable getting to the bottom of a heartbreak or finding that inexplicable turn of phrase that unlocks a song.
